
Summary of the death of Lashkar-e-Taiba Commander Razaullah Nizamani
In a shocking development, senior Lashkar-e-Taiba (LeT) terrorist commander Razaullah Nizamani has been killed in Sindh province, Pakistan. The incident was reported by Visegrád 24 on Twitter, highlighting that Nizamani was shot to death by "unknown gunmen." This event marks a significant moment in the ongoing battle against terrorism in the region, particularly concerning the activities of LeT, an organization primarily focused on jihad in Kashmir.

The Role of Lashkar-e-Taiba
Lashkar-e-Taiba is a Pakistan-based militant organization that has been involved in numerous terror activities, most notably in Jammu and Kashmir. Founded in the late 1980s, the group aims to establish Islamic rule in the region and has been linked to several high-profile attacks, including the infamous 2008 Mumbai attacks. The organization is considered a terrorist group by several countries, including India, the United States, and the European Union.
The LeT has been instrumental in recruiting and training militants to carry out attacks against Indian forces and other targets in Kashmir. Their ideology is rooted in an extremist interpretation of Islam, which they use to justify their violent actions. The Lashkar-e-Taiba: A Brief Overview
The Lashkar-e-Taiba, often abbreviated as LeT, is a jihadist organization that primarily operates in Pakistan and aims to establish Islamic rule in Kashmir. Formed in the late 1980s, the group has been involved in various violent activities, including armed conflict and terrorist attacks against Indian forces and civilians. The organization has been designated as a terrorist group by several countries, including the United States and India.
